Free Crochet Pattern for Owl

Learn to crochet a super sweet owl wearing a hat and pants with this easy-to-follow free pattern! It will surely steal hearts! Using only simple stitches like single crochet, increase and decrease, you will creat a charming amigurumi! It can be used as decoration and as a little gift. A lovely giveaway for friends and relatives. This amigurumi is also the perfect companion for every child, whether it is to play or travel with. It´s a very simple design which can be made in any desired colors. If you’re looking to practice crocheting in the round, this is the perfect pattern to practice with! The pattern is very detailed. It comes with easy-to-follow written instructions and photo tutorial. Scroll down to see the step-by-step written instructions and supplies you’ll need.

SUPPLIES YOU NEED

Before you begin, make sure you have the following materials:

cotton yarn (e.g. Schachenmayr Catania 125m/50g) in the following colors: beige, brown, light green and white, a bit of pink for the booties and orange for the beak, crochet hook 2,5 mm, Polyester fiberfill or any stuffing material of your choice, chopstick or something similar to help with stuffing small parts, stitch marker, scissors, yarn needle for weaving in ends and sewing parts together, black buttons or two black beads 7 mm, one button, scissors.

Feel free to replace these materials with others of your choice. Using different materials and hook size to what is recommended may alter the final appearance of your amigurumi.

SKILL LEVEL

I would classify this free crochet pattern as an advanced beginner. It is necessary to have some experience with amigurumi before creating this project.

FINISHED SIZE  

The ready amigurumi is approx. 17 cm high, from bottom to top, can be made bigger or smaller depending on the yarn and hook you use. Use thicker yarn if you want to create a bigger bird.

SKILLS YOU NEED

chain, single crochet, double crochet, half double crochet, slip stitch, increase, decrease, front post double crochet

ABBREVIATIONS

Ch =chain

St = stitch

Sc = single crochet

Sl st = slip stitch

dec = decrease stitch (two single crochets together)

inc = increase stitch (two single crochets in the one stitch)

Dc = double crochet

Hdc = half double crochet

Tc = treble crochet

Rnd = Round

* = repeat the instructions for the times indicated

(...) = at the end of every round total amount of stitches is indicated

TIPS

  • Do not join rounds, work in a continuous spiral
  • Place a stitch marker or a piece of yarn at the beginning stitch of the round and move it up at the start of each additional round
  • This pattern doesn´t include any specific stitch tutorials
  • All stitches are worked into both loops, unless stated otherwise in the pattern
  • The number of stitches for completion is noted in parentheses at the end of each round
  • When filling with polyester stuffing, pull apart each large chunk into many smaller chunks. This ensures an even distribution of firmness within the amigurumi
  • Amigurumi can be made in any desired colors
  • The pattern is written in English using US crochet terminology
  • Work the pattern in the order as shown below, because it is joined together as it is made.

Seamless way of changing color when working in the round

Pick up the new color at the end of the round: inset your hook into the stitch, yarn over the new color and pull through the stitch and the loop on your hook to complete the stitch.

To make a magic ring

  1. Loop the thread twice around your middle finger
  2. Put the hook under both loops, pull the yarn under the loops and hook the thread again
  3. Pull the thread through the new loop. The first crochet stitch is ready!
  4. Repeat the number of times needed.
  5. Pull the inner threads to tighten the ring.

INSTRUCTIONS

The owl consists of several parts which you crochet separately and then sew them together.

BOOT (2x)

Crochet with pink colored yarn.

Round 1: 6 single crochets into Magic Ring.

Round 2: increase 6 times (12 stitches)

Round 3: *single crochet in next stitch, increase* (18 stitches)

Round 4: (*single crochet in next stitch, increase*, repeat from* to* 3 times, single crochet in each of next 3 stitches), repeat twice (24 stitches)

Continue crocheting in rounds:

Round 5 (working into the back loop): single crochet in each of next 24 stitches

Rounds 6-7: single crochet in each of next 24 stitches

Round 8: decrease 5 times, single crochet in each of next 6 stitches, decrease, single crochet in each of next 6 stitches (18 stitches)

Do not fasten off and continue crocheting in rounds.

Round 9: single crochet in each of next 18 stitches

Round 10: *single crochet in the next stitch, decrease* (12 stitches)

Stuff the bootie firmly. Do not fasten off.

LEG (2x)

Continue crocheting in rounds:

Change the color of yarn to green

Round 1 (working into the back loop): single crochet in each of next 12 stitches

Round 2: single crochet in each of next 12 stitches

Do not fasten off.

Change the color of yarn to beige

Round 3 (working into the back loop): single crochet in each of next 12 stitches

Working into the front loop with pink colored yarn: chain 2 stitches, half double crochet in each of next stitch till the end of the round.

Fasten off, hide yarn ends.

Work on round in single crochet´s around the sole of the bootie if desired.

Working into the front loop with green colored yarn: chain 1 stitch, single crochet in each of next stitch till the end of the round.

Fasten off, hide yarn ends.

Continue crocheting with beige colored yarn:

Round 4: *single crochet in each of next 3 stitches, increase* (15 stitches)

Round 5: single crochet in each of next 15 stitches

Round 6: *single crochet in each of next 4 stitches, increase* (18 stitches)

Round 7: single crochet in each of next 18 stitches

Stuff firmly. Fasten off the first leg.

Work the second leg the same way but don´t fasten off!

SHIFT STITCH

Sometimes during the work of the spiral amigurumi, you need to keep the work symmetrically. As work tends to twist to the right you need to adjust position of the marker periodically (beginning of the round).

Shift stitch is an extra stitch you work at the end of a round to make your work look symmetrical. If you notice that marker moves right, you need to work one extra stitch in the end of the round and move marker for one stitch (now second stitch of the round becomes first). This is the shift stitch.

The shift stitch is not included in the round description. To check if it’s time to work shift stitch fold your work in half and check if marker still goes straight or use a yarn that marks a straight line.

You may think this is an increase, but it isn’t. This way you don’t increase or decrease the number of stitches. The stitches count remains the same.

BODY and HEAD

We start crocheting from the head and then continue on the body. Work with beige yarn.

Round 1: 6 single crochets into Magic Ring (alternative: if preferred, chain 2 stitches and then 6 single crochets in the second chain from hook) (6 stitches)

Round 2: increase 6 times (12 stitches)

Round 3: *single crochet in next stitch, increase* (18 stitches)

Round 4: *single crochet in each of next 2 stitches, increase* (24 stitches)

Round 5: *single crochet in each of next 3 stitches, increase* (30 stitches)

Round 6: *single crochet in each of next 4 stitches, increase* (36 stitches)

Round 7: *single crochet in each of next 5 stitches, increase* (42 stitches)

Round 8: *single crochet in each of next 6 stitches, increase* (48 stitches)

Round 9: *single crochet in each of next 7 stitches, increase* (54 stitches)

Change the color of yarn

Round 10 (working into the back loop): single crochet in each of next 54 stitches

Rounds 11-19: single crochet in each of next 54 stitches

Round 20: *decrease, single crochet in each of next 7 stitches* (48 stitches)

Rounds 21-25: single crochet in each of next 48 stitches

Round 26: *decrease, single crochet in each of next 6 stitches* (42 stitches)

Rounds 27-31: single crochet in each of next 42 stitches

Round 32: *decrease, single crochet in each of next 5 stitches* (36 stitches)

Start stuffing the body and continue stuffing as you go.

Round 33: *decrease, single crochet in each of next 4 stitches* (30 stitches)

Round 34: *decrease, single crochet in each of next 3 stitches* (24 stitches)

Round 35: *decrease, single crochet in each of next 2 stitches* (18 stitches)

Round 36: *decrease, single crochet in the next stitch* (12 stitches)

Stuff the body firmly with fiberfill.

Round 37: *decrease*.

Fasten off. Cut the yarn leaving a tail and pull through last st. Weave the yarn tail through the front loops only of the final round and pull to close. Hide the end inside the body.

WING (2x)

Work in brown colored yarn.

3 tips:

Round 1: 6 single crochets into Magic Ring.

Round 2: *increase, single crochet in next stitch* (9 stitches)

Rounds 3-6: single crochet in each of next 9 stitches.

Fasten off. Tip Nr.3 work the same way but do not fasten off!

Round 7: work one round in single crochet´s over all tips (27 stitches)

Continue crocheting in rounds:

Round 8: single crochet in each of next 27 stitches

Round 9: *decrease, single crochet in each of next 7 stitches* (24 stitches)

Round 10: single crochet in each of next 24 stitches

Round 11: *decrease, single crochet in each of next 2 stitches* (18 stitches)

Rounds 12-13: single crochet in each of next 18 stitches

Round 14: *decrease, single crochet in the next stitch* (12 stitches)

Rounds 15-16: single crochet in each of next 12 stitches

Fasten off leaving a long yarn tail for sewing. Work the second wing the same wing. The wings don´t need to be stuffed.

EYE PATCH & EYELID (2x)

Work in white colored yarn.

Work 12 double crochets into a magic ring.

Fasten off leaving a long tail for sewing.

EYENLID (2x)

Work in white colored yarn.

Work 7 half double crochets into a magic ring.

Fasten off leaving a long tail for sewing.

BEAK

Crochet with orange colored yarn.

Round 1: 3 single crochets into Magic Ring.

Round 2: *increase every stitch* (6 stitches)

Round 3: single crochet in each of next 6 stitches

Round 4: *increase, single crochet in next stitch* (9 stitches)

Round 5: *increase, single crochet in each of next 2 stitches* (12 stitches)

Round 6: *decrease, single crochet in each of next 2 stitches* (9 stitches)

Cut the yarn leaving a long tail for sewing.

ASSEMBLY

Since all the elements of your amigurumi are crocheted, it´s time to sew them together. Use a blunt sewing needle.

Attach the beak to the head. Mark where you want the eyes to be placed with pins, position eye patches and sew them with the distance of 4-6 stitches to the head of the owl. 

Sew two black buttons or black beads onto the white parts of the eyes.

Sew the eyelids to the eyes as shown on the pic above. Hide yarn ends inside the head.

Wings are attached to the sides of the body now. Thread a needle on one of the yarn tails left from the wings, place the wings in their right place on the body. Be sure to step back and take a look to make sure they are even.

Now sew the legs to the bottom of the body of your owl. Weave in the yarn end. Now the owl is finished!

HAT

Regarding the instructions for the hat, I have indicated where the color change should start and continue.

Start crocheting with green yarn.

Round 1: 6 half double crochets into Magic Ring (alternative: if preferred, chain 3 stitches and then 6 half double crochets in the 3rd chain from hook) (6 stitches)

Round 2: chain 2 stitches, half double crochet in each of next 6 stitches

Change the color of yarn to white

Round 3: chain 2 stitches, increase 6 times (12 stitches)

Change the color of yarn to green

Round 4: chain 2 stitches, half double crochet in each of next 12 stitches

Change the color of yarn to white

Round 5: chain 2 stitches, *increase, single crochet in each of next 3 stitches* (15 stitches)

Change the color of yarn to green

Round 6: chain 2 stitches, half double crochet in each of next 15 stitches

Change the color of yarn to white

Round 7: chain 2 stitches, *increase, single crochet in each of next 4 stitches* (18 stitches)

Change the color of yarn to green

Round 8: chain 2 stitches, *increase, single crochet in each of next 2 stitches* (24 stitches)

Change the color of yarn to white

Round 9: chain 2 stitches, half double crochet in each of next 24 stitches

Change the color of yarn to green

Round 10: chain 2 stitches, half double crochet in each of next 24 stitches

Change the color of yarn to white

Round 11: chain 2 stitches, half double crochet in each of next 24 stitches

Change the color of yarn to green

Round 12: chain 2 stitches, *increase, single crochet in each of next 7 stitches* (27 stitches)

Change the color of yarn to white

Round 13: chain 2 stitches, half double crochet in each of next 27 stitches

Change the color of yarn to green

Round 14: chain 2 stitches, half double crochet in each of next 27 stitches

Change the color of yarn to white

Round 15: chain 2 stitches, *increase, single crochet in each of next 8 stitches* (30 stitches)

Change the color of yarn to green

Round 16: chain 2 stitches, half double crochet in each of next 30 stitches

Change the color of yarn to white

Round 17: chain 2 stitches, *increase, single crochet in each of next 4 stitches* (36 stitches)

Change the color of yarn to green

Round 18: chain 2 stitches, half double crochet in each of next 36 stitches

Change the color of yarn to white

Round 19: chain 2 stitches, half double crochet in each of next 36 stitches

Change the color of yarn to green

Round 20: chain 2 stitches, half double crochet in each of next 36 stitches

Round 21: chain 2 stitches, *increase, single crochet in each of next 5 stitches* (42 stitches)

Round 22: chain 2 stitches, half double crochet in each of next 42 stitches

Change the color of yarn to white

Round 23: chain 2 stitches, half double crochet in each of next 42 stitches

Change the color of yarn to green

Round 24: chain 2 stitches, *increase, single crochet in each of next 6 stitches* (48 stitches)

Rounds 25-27: chain 2 stitches, half double crochet in each of next 48 stitches

Fasten off leaving a long tail for sewing.

PANTS

The pants are worked in a single piece from the down top. The work begins at legs and continues up to the waist.

Crochet with light green color or any color of yarn you wish.

Chain 62 stitches, join for crocheting in rounds with a slip stitch.

Rounds 1-5: chain 2 stitches, half double crochet in each of next 62 stitches, slip stitch to the top of chain 2

Round 6: chain 2 stitches, half double crochet in each of next 13 stitches, 2 hdc together, half double crochet in the next stitch, 2 hdc together, half double crochet in each of next 26 stitches, 2 hdc together, half double crochet in the next stitch, 2 hdc together, half double crochet in each of next 13 stitches.

Rounds 7-8: chain 2 stitches, half double crochet in each of next 58 stitches, slip stitch to the top of chain 2

Round 9: chain 2 stitches, half double crochet in each of next 12 stitches, 2 hdc together, half double crochet in the next stitch, 2 hdc together, half double crochet in each of next 24 stitches, 2 hdc together, half double crochet in the next stitch, 2 hdc together, half double crochet in each of next 12 stitches.

Round 10: chain 2 stitches, half double crochet in each of next 54 stitches, slip stitch to the top of chain 2

For the strap chain 75 stitches. Fasten off leaving a long tail for sewing to the pants. Hide yarn ends.

Attach a button to the pants. Seam the middle 4 stitches. Hide all yarn ends. Ready!
